Prep Time: 10 mins
Cook Time: -
Total Time: 10 mins
Cuisine: American
Serves: 2 servings

Ingredients

  1. 1 cup wild blueberries
  2. 1 medium apple, diced
  3. 1 banana
  4. 1 cup almond milk
  5. 1/2 cup granola
  6. 1 tablespoon honey (optional)
  7. 1 teaspoon cinnamon

Instructions

  1. Gather all ingredients and ensure they are fresh and ripe. Wash the apple thoroughly and remove the core before dicing.
  2. Place the frozen wild blueberries, diced apple, and banana into a high-powered blender. The frozen blueberries will help create a thick, creamy consistency.
  3. Pour the almond milk into the blender. If you prefer a thicker smoothie, use slightly less milk; for a thinner consistency, add a bit more.
  4. Add the honey and ground cinnamon to enhance the flavor profile. The honey will provide natural sweetness, while cinnamon adds warmth and depth.
  5. Blend the ingredients on high speed for 45-60 seconds until smooth and creamy, with no visible chunks of fruit.
  6. Pour the smoothie into two serving bowls, using a spatula to ensure all the mixture is transferred.
  7. Top each bowl with granola, creating a delightful crunch that mimics an apple crumble texture.
  8. Optional: Garnish with additional fresh blueberries, apple slices, or a sprinkle of extra cinnamon for visual appeal and added flavor.
  9. Serve immediately to enjoy the smoothie at its freshest and most vibrant temperature.

Tips

  1. Choose Fresh Ingredients: Always opt for ripe and fresh fruits to maximize flavor. If you can, use organic produce for the best taste and health benefits.
  2. Frozen Blueberries: Using frozen wild blueberries not only gives your smoothie a thicker consistency but also keeps it refreshingly cold without needing ice.
  3. Adjust Consistency: Feel free to tweak the amount of almond milk based on your texture preference. Less milk yields a thicker smoothie, while more will create a lighter blend.
  4. Sweeten to Taste: The honey is optional, so taste your smoothie before adding it. If your fruits are sweet enough, you might not need any extra sweetness!
  5. Blend Well: Make sure to blend the mixture thoroughly until smooth. A high-powered blender will give you the best results, ensuring no chunks remain.
  6. Creative Toppings: Get creative with your toppings! Consider adding nuts, seeds, or even a dollop of yogurt for extra texture and flavor.
  7. Serve Immediately: For the best experience, serve your smoothie bowls right after preparation. This way, you can enjoy the freshness and vibrant flavors at their peak.
